
KLHS Webmaster is currently reading a novel set in 19th century Kingston. Though renamed as “Harberscombe”, the village is recognisable through the colourful description of its character and layout as well as the surrounding coast and countryside. Even the villagers’ surnames are familiar – Luggers and Triggs amongst them. Michael Weston was, we understand, a resident of Kingston. Grace Pensilva was published in 1985 and secondhand copies can be found online. A review will follow…
